SALT LAKE CITY — Police are investigating a shooting in the Liberty Wells neighborhood that injured one man.
Salt Lake police said the investigation started just after 7:30 p.m. when officers received the report of a shooting near 180 E. Kensington Avenue. When officers arrived, they found a 40-year-old man with a gunshot wound.
The man was taken to a hospital with injuries that are did not appear life-threatening.
Detectives have determined multiple shots were fired by an unknown person or persons and at least one bullet hit a nearby house. Police said witnesses saw the suspect or suspects leave westbound on Kensington Avenue in a car.
Further details were not immediately available, but police said there does not appear to be an imminent danger to the community even though no arrests have been made yet. No description of the suspect or car has been released.
